2009. 1st Edition. Paperback. Mobile devices outnumber desktop and laptop computers by three to one worldwide, yet little information is available for designing and developing mobile applications. This title offers practical guidelines, standards, techniques, and some of the best practices for building mobile products from start to finish. Num Pages: 336 pages, 1, black & white illustrations.
